What is subsurface underground gas storage
Subsurface underground gas storage refers to the practice of storing natural gas in underground rock formations or depleted oil and gas fields to manage supply and demand fluctuations.

What is subsurface underground gas storage?
Subsurface underground gas storage refers to a method of storing natural gas in underground formations to ensure energy supply stability. This process is critical for balancing supply and demand, particularly during peak usage times. Key stakeholders, including gas producers, utilities, and regulatory bodies, collaborate to manage such agreements effectively.
How does the legal framework impact gas storage agreements?
Legal regulations play a crucial role in overseeing gas storage operations. These regulations can govern safety standards, environmental considerations, and the technical aspects of gas storage. Various types of agreements are used in this industry, including long-term leases, which delineate the roles and responsibilities of both lessors and lessees.
